Shimmers the Shivery Moon, for flute, clarinet, violin, cello, and piano
composed by Kai-Young Chan
Taken by one recitation of Song Dynasty Chinese poet Li Shangyin's Poem without a Title, the composer was inspired to express through music the strong impact and resonance of a particular line (夜吟應覺月光寒), which translates as: "Amid the chant of the night shimmers the shivery moon". The line concludes the poet's melancholy stemming from the sudden realization of aging and the grief of parting.
This piece is an artistic response aiming to depict the poetic landscapes through the interaction between two musical ideas of contrasting character, which serve to recreate a wrestling between darkness and light, between imaginary and reality, between fond memories and the bitter present.
